Nasarawa United Coach Salisu Yusuf Laments Defeat to Kwara United
Nasarawa United head coach, Salisu Yusuf, has expressed disappointment over his team's defeat to Kwara United, insisting they deserved more from the game, DAILY POST reports.
An own goal by Emeka Onyema in the 64th minute was the decisive moment, handing Kwara United the victory and ending Nasarawa United's impressive eight-game unbeaten streak.
Yusuf lamented the outcome, stating that his team played well but was unfortunate to leave without a positive result.
”The boys did well, and gave the opponents a good match today, even though we should have won this game,” Yusuf told the club's media.
“This is my first loss since I took over the helm of affairs at the club. I have been using the available players to prosecute the remainder of the games. They are good potentials, I must say.
“However, we are choosing to focus on the positives on today's game and use this as an opportunity to regroup and come back stronger in our next two home games.”
The Solid Miners will host Akwa United in their next league game on April 6.
